So I have a code where it speaks and shows the time, but I really want my code to speak the time I enter.
Right now I have:
res=input('','s');
if strcmpi(res,'What is the time')
NET.addAssembly('System.Speech');
obj = System.Speech.Synthesis.SpeechSynthesizer;
obj.Volume = 100;
Speak(obj, 'this is the time' )
fprintf('%s\n', datestr(now,'HH:MM:SS'))
s=-1;
k=1;
end
It speaks out but tells the current time. Is there a way to make it speak the time a user enters? Please provide an example. Thank you.

Try this. It works. Adapt as needed.
% Instantiate the speech .Net assembly (for Windows only - not Apple!!)
NET.addAssembly('System.Speech');
obj = System.Speech.Synthesis.SpeechSynthesizer;
obj.Volume = 100;
% Have the computer tell us the current time.
Speak(obj, 'This is the current time')
string2 = sprintf('%s', datestr(now,'HH:MM:SS'))
Speak(obj, string2)
% Now let the user enter something.
Speak(obj, 'Now it is your turn to enter a time')
string3 = input('Enter a time in the form HH:MM:SS : ', 's')
Speak(obj, string3)
